Official NHTSA Safety Recalls (1)
AIR BAGS:SENSOR:OCCUPANT CLASSIFICATION
Summary: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ing (Toyota) is recalling certain 2020-2021 Avalon, Avalon Hybrid, Corolla, Highlander, Highlander Hybrid, RAV4, RAV4 Hybrid, Lexus ES350, Lexus RX350, Lexus RX450H, 2021 Sienna Hybrid, Lexus ES250, 2020-2022 Camry, Camry Hybrid, and ES300H vehicles. A short circuit may develop in the Occupant Classification System (OCS) sensor, preventing the front passenger air bag from deploying.

Is the 2021 Lexus ES a reliable used car?
The 2021 Lexus ES earns a 8/10 MazicBay Reliability Index based on 28 federal owner reports. Vehicles maintained under factory service schedules exhibit strong longevity past 150,000 miles.
What is the most frequent defect reported on the 2021 Lexus ES?
The leading complaint category is Airbag Occupant Detection & Inflator Defect Reports, with a median failure point around 55,000 miles (IQR: 35,000 – 75,000 mi).
Are there free recall repairs available for the 2021 Lexus ES?
Yes, the NHTSA records 1 safety recall campaign(s) for this model year. All safety recalls are performed 100% free of charge by authorized franchise dealerships regardless of vehicle warranty status.
